Computational and Complexity Theory

Computational Complexity
4.40 (5 reviews)
Udemy
platform
English
language
Other
category
instructor
Computational and Complexity Theory
1 735
students
1.5 hours
content
Jun 2022
last update
FREE
regular price

Why take this course?


Headline: 🚀 Dive into the World of Computational Complexity with "Computational and Complexity Theory"!

Course Title: Computational and Complexity Theory

Course Instructor: Gayathri VM

Course Description:

Are you ready to unlock the mysteries of computational complexity and understand the intricacies of computational theory? "Computational and Complexity Theory" is the perfect course for anyone interested in computer science, mathematics, or just curious about how computers solve problems. 🧐

What You'll Learn:

  • Introduction to Languages: Get familiar with the fundamental concepts of decidable, undecidable, recursive, and recursively enumerable languages. 📚

  • Decidable Languages Unveiled: Explore examples and understand what makes a language decidable. Learn about the differences between these languages and their implications in problem-solving. 🔍

  • Problems, Theorems, and Rice's Legacy: Delve into the world of problems and theorems that define computational theory. Master the Non-Trivial Property, a cornerstone in understanding the famous Rice Theorem. 🏛️

  • Engaging with Interactive Content: Engage with quizzes and Q&A sessions designed to solidify your understanding of these complex topics. 🎓

  • The Post Correspondence Problem (PCP): Grasp the concept of the undecidable PCP and its significance in computational theory. Learn how it differs from its modified version, the Modified Post Correspondence Problem (MPCP). 🤔

  • Conversion and Examples: Understand the conversion of MPCP to PCP with a step-by-step example provided in the course material. 📝

  • Undecidability Explained: Discover why the PCP is considered undecidable and how this distinction sets it apart from decidable problems. 🌀

  • Complexity Classes Demystified: Clarify your understanding of complexity classes P, NP, NP-Hard, and NP-Complete. Learn how they are distinct from one another and their role in solving different types of problems. 🤓

Why Take This Course?

  • Expert Instruction: Learn from Gayathri VM, an instructor with a passion for making complex concepts accessible and engaging. 🧑‍🏫

  • Real-World Applications: Apply your newfound knowledge to real-world problems and scenarios. 🌍

  • Interactive Learning Experience: Benefit from a course designed with interactive elements to keep you engaged and help solidify your understanding. 🎧

  • Valuable Skills: Equip yourself with the skills needed to navigate the complex landscape of computational theory, which is fundamental in fields like algorithms, cryptography, artificial intelligence, and more. 🚀

Don't miss this opportunity to expand your knowledge and expertise in one of the most fascinating areas of computer science. Enroll in "Computational and Complexity Theory" today and transform the way you think about computational problems! 🎓✨

Course Gallery

Computational and Complexity Theory – Screenshot 1
Screenshot 1Computational and Complexity Theory
Computational and Complexity Theory – Screenshot 2
Screenshot 2Computational and Complexity Theory
Computational and Complexity Theory – Screenshot 3
Screenshot 3Computational and Complexity Theory
Computational and Complexity Theory – Screenshot 4
Screenshot 4Computational and Complexity Theory

Loading charts...

4663310
udemy ID
28/04/2022
course created date
26/06/2022
course indexed date
Bot
course submited by